How to survive the flight to Marta?
We’ve got the lowdown on how to make your flight an enjoyable experience. Follow our tips and you’ll be hightailing it through airport security and discovering Marta in no time flat.What to pack in your hand luggage:

  • It’s simple — first, put in your passport, important documents, credit cards and medications. Next, you’ll need some entertainment to help pass the time. A thrilling novel and a laptop crammed with your favorite movies are some fantastic options. If you plan to take a short nap, a quality neck pillow and a pair of earplugs will also be useful. Finally, make room for a few toiletry items so you’ll touchdown looking fresh and ready to go.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Leave all your full-sized bottles of shampoo and hair gel in your checked luggage. Any gels or liquids in your carry-on suitcase lar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) will be confiscated by security. Pointed or sharp objects, like a Swiss Army knife, and dangerous products which are flammable or explosive, such as aerosols and strong acids, are also restricted.

What to wear on a flight:

  • The best way to ensure a comfortable flight is often as simple as your choice of clothes. Prepare for temperature changes by layering up. This will keep you nice and warm if the cabin begins to cool down. Shoes like high heels and sandals are best left in your suitcase. Even though they may be your favorites, opt for flat, closed-toed footwear like slip-ons. Your feet will appreciate it.
  • Most travelers have heard about DVT (deep vein thrombosis), a blood clotting condition caused by long periods of inactivity. There are many ways to mitigate your risk. Wear a good-quality pair of compression tights or socks, drink lots of water often and remember to keep your legs and feet moving. Walk the aisles of the cabin or perform some stretches in your seat.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Marta?
Being organized before you get to the airport will help make your trip to Marta easy and painless. We’ve rounded up some handy tips for a stress-free journey through security:

  • Be sure to keep your boarding pass and passport close by. They’re the first items you’ll be asked to show at airport security.
  • After that, both you and your carry-on bag will be X-rayed. To make the process quick and painless, remove anything that is likely to trigger the alarm. Items such as your belt, coat and earphones will be required to go through the machine.
  • All electronic devices, including your phone and laptop, are also required to be scanned separately.
  • Remove liquids and gels from your carry-on luggage. They usually need to be sent through the X-ray scanner separately. Each item should be in a container no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) and everything must fit inside a quart-size (one liter), clear zip-lock bag.
  • There’s a good chance you’ll be asked to remove your shoes to be X-rayed, so wearing slip-on shoes is always a clever idea.
  • Pocket knives and other sharp items are not allowed in the cabin. They’ll be seized at security, so put them in your checked luggage.
